CUNNIFF ERA BEGINS WITH 2-0 DEFEAT IN MILWAUKEE

Iowa Travels to Chicago to Meet The Wolves Thursday at 7 PM

MILWAUKEE, WI  – The Iowa Wild (15-30-3-3, 36 points) were defeated by the Milwaukee Admirals (30-14-3-0, 63 points) 2-0 in front of 14,075 fans on Sunday at the BMO Harris Bradley Center. Playing its third game over the last three days, the Iowa Wild failed to beat Milwaukee goalie Marek Mazanec (15-8-3), who made 23 saves for his eighth career shutout.  Video review was needed to confirm the eventual game-winning goal by Admirals forward Kevin Fiala and Max Reinhart added an empty-net goal for the team’s 30th win of the year. Iowa goalie Leland Irving (7-15-3) made 21 saves on 22 shots in the one-goal defeat. Iowa’s David Cunniff made his head-coaching debut after he was named the third head coach in team history on Saturday night. Iowa visits Chicago at 7 p.m. on Thursday.

After a scoreless first period, Kevin Fiala broke open the game with a wraparound goal that was reviewed before it was awarded the Admirals. Defenseman Trevor Murphy set up Fiala at 12:40 of the second period, as the Milwaukee forward swept in behind the Iowa net and slipped a wraparound off the left leg pad of goalie Leland Irving. Video review revealed Irving’s pad was behind the goal-line, allowing the puck to cross the line for Fiala’s ninth goal of the season and a 1-0 lead.

Irving was pulled in the final two minutes in favor of an extra attacker. Milwaukee forward Max Reinhart fired the puck from the red line at 19:10, scoring an empty-net goal from Colton Sissons for the 2-0 final.  

Iowa continues a three-game road trip on Thursday, Feb. 18 in Chicago. The team will make one more stop in Milwaukee before returning home for two games against the Manitoba Moose on Monday, Feb. 22 and Wednesday, Feb. 24.
